Pool Fence Regulations Forestdale MA Comprehending Pool Fence Laws

Grasping pool fence guidelines is crucial for ensuring the safety of your swimming area. These laws are intended to prevent accidents and enhance security, especially for families with young children and pets. By complying with these guidelines, you can maintain a secure and compliant pool space.

- Height and Material Requirements: One of the primary aspects of pool fence regulations is height and material specifications. Most guidelines mandate that pool fences must be a minimum of four feet high to stop young kids from entering the pool area. The fence must be constructed from sturdy materials such as metal, vinyl, or wood, ensuring it can withstand weather conditions and provide long-lasting security. Mesh fences are also popular as they are climb-resistant and hard for children to climb.

- Gate and Latch Specifications: Another critical aspect of pool fence regulations is the specifications for gates and latches. Gates must be self-closing and self-latching to ensure they automatically close and lock behind you. The latch should be positioned beyond the reach of young kids, usually at least 54 inches high. This design prevents children from opening the gate and gaining access to the pool area. Furthermore, gates need to open outward away from the pool, to prevent children from pushing them open and entering the pool.

Ensuring Compliance and Enhancing Safety

Ensuring compliance with pool fence regulations not only enhances safety but also protects you from legal issues. Consistently inspecting your fence and performing needed repairs keeps it effective and compliant.

- Routine Fence Inspections and Maintenance: To maintain your pool fence's compliance and effectiveness, routine inspections and maintenance are essential. Check for any damage or wear that could weaken the fence. Loose posts, broken latches, or rusted components need to be repaired or replaced promptly to maintain the fence's security. Routine maintenance helps prolong the life of your fence and ensures it continues to meet safety regulations.

- Upgrading to Meet New Standards: Pool fence guidelines can be updated, so it's important to stay informed about new requirements. Updating your pool fence to comply with new regulations ensures ongoing compliance and maximizes safety. This might include installing new self-closing gates, adding extra locks, or reinforcing current structures. By being proactive, you can keep your pool a safe and enjoyable place for all family and friends.
